More about G96® Brand Triple Action Gun Treatment® - 4.5 oz.
An easy way to clean, lubricate and protect your gun, G96 Brand Triple Action Gun Treatment leaves no gummy residue. This all-in-one cleaner contains solvents that completely remove all traces of rust, gunpowder, leading and corrosion in seconds. No solvent or preservation is necessary. 4.5 oz.
Features:
- Solvents completely remove all traces of rust, gun powder, leading and corrosion in seconds
- Contains lubricants which will not freeze, oxidize, or evaporate
- Leaves no gummy residue
- Keeps firing pin and all moving parts working in temps as low as -50° F
- Insures perfect firing every time
- Leaves an invisible magnetic film over metal parts to protect your gun against under all weather conditions
- Safe for use on polymers
- Contents: 4.5 oz aerosol can
Directions For Use:
- Spray evenly over area to be treated
- Allow to set for 60 seconds
- Wipe with clean cloth
- Apply to all metal surfaces, inside chamber and inside barrel
- Wipe after application
- When treating gun for first time or for long term storage protection, spray three times, wiping dry after first and second application
- Note: After treating gun allow solvent contained in the oil to evaporate for 10 minutes before placing gun in any airtight container such as a case, sealed carton, etc.
